专业DBA的职业习惯及操作原则


DBA信条数据无价,数据绝对不能丢!

1.在去客户现场之前,要和客户电话沟通,了解工作的范围和重点,然后提前做一些功课,把与工作相关的内容准备好。每个人的能力都是有限的,知识面也都存在一些短板,做好充分的准备是对客户的负责,也是对自己的负责。
2.学会倾听,认真听取客户的想法、客户对工作的希望以及对项目的理解,这对于提高客户的满意度十分专业。无论技术多么优秀,任务完成多么出色,不合客户口味也是没有用的。
3.操作之前,应打开各种能够记录操作过程的日志,甚至是录屏。比如,打开secureCRT工具的会话日志。这样可以避免一些不必要的纠纷。
4.事先在自己的编辑器中写好所有的操作,最后再黏贴到虚拟终端上去执行。这个习惯一方面可以将每次操作的脚本都记录下来,另一方面也可以帮助我们在执行之前审阅脚本,最关键的是,可以避免在虚拟终端上的误操作。
5.碰到自己无法把控风险的操作,尽可能咨询一下其他人,或者尽早将其升级到二线或三线,千万不要把自己置于未知风险的危险境地。当我们以团队的方式来工作,没有必要一个人来承担所有的风险(有些风险,个人是无法承担的!)。
6.在离开客户现场前,要和相关负责人进行沟通,说明本次工作的内容,做了什么事情,有什么遗留问题,有什么后续建议。这一方面体现自己的专业性,也是对客户的负责。如果可能,可将项目工作内容整理成文档形式,交予客户。
7.完成一个项目后,应尽快写一份文档记录本次工作。编写文档过程中,对本次操作进行总结,也对自己做一次评审,看看操作过程中是否存在需要改进的问题。

注:以上7条摘自《DBA的思想天空》

8.多看少动不删除。当要对数据库进行操作之前,尽可能的收集数据库的信息,了解当前数据库的情况,只做和解决问题相关的必须操作,除了已确认删除后对生产库没有任何影响的文件,不轻易做任何删除操作。
9.处理问题过程中,注意保留现场,做任何操作都要像oracle undo机制,当操作不成功,可以还原现场。坚决不能出现处理一个问题,引发其他一系列其他问题,陷入无休止的问题排查中,所以,在条件允许下,能做冷备尽量做冷备。
10.远程连接过程中,注意密码的保护,不将密码写入连接串中(如sqlplus oracle/oracle@testdb)。而应该分为两步进行连接:先输入sqlplus oracle@testdb,当出现提示密码输入时,再数据密码。


来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/30167136/viewspace-1570618/,如需转载,请注明出处,否则将追究法律责任。

转载于:http://blog.itpub.net/30167136/viewspace-1570618/

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值